LENS BASED MEDIA- ‘FACE VALUE’ (NETWORKS AND SYSTEMS)
Faces are fundamentally important to social life. ‘we are not solitary mammals like the fox or the tiger; we are genetically social. what is most profoundly felt between is, even if hidden, will reappear in our portraits of one another’. The network of faces we negotiate a daily basis, are not only of the physical, flesh and blood variety, but the ageless, de-fect free, care-free, cloned faces of the billboard and glossy magazine page. Today, photographers who wish to say something meaningful about the face are looking for strategies and tactics to match its rapidly evolving social and technological environment. we are expected to interact both on a physical level and a rapidly evolving artificial social media level.
